What is Albuterol sulfate and budesonide?

AIRSUPRA 90 ug/1 combines albuterol sulfate and budesonide for respiratory conditions. This metered aerosol inhaler offers dual-action relief for asthma and COPD management.

What is Albuterol sulfate and budesonide used for?

AIRSUPRA 90 ug/1 is primarily used for the maintenance and prevention of asthma and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). The combination of albuterol sulfate and budesonide works to open airways and reduce inflammation. This inhaler is often prescribed for long-term management of respiratory conditions where both bronchodilation and anti-inflammatory effects are beneficial.

What does Albuterol sulfate and budesonide interact with?

AIRSUPRA 90 ug/1 may interact with other medications, including beta-blockers, diuretics, and certain antidepressants.
